Check Digit Verification of cas no

The CAS Registry Mumber 23377-53-9 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 2,3,3,7 and 7 respectively; the second part has 2 digits, 5 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 23377-53:
(7*2)+(6*3)+(5*3)+(4*7)+(3*7)+(2*5)+(1*3)=109
109 % 10 = 9
So 23377-53-9 is a valid CAS Registry Number.

Ultraviolet-Visible Spectroscopic Studies on Manganese and Rhenium Oxide Fluorides in Low-temperature Matrices

Brisdon, Alan K.,Holloway, John H.,Hope, Eric G.,Townson, Paul J.,Levason, William,Ogden, J. Steven

, p. 3127 - 3132 (1991)

Five high-oxidation-state metal oxide fluorides, MnO3F, ReO3F, ReO2F3, ReOF5 and ReOF4 have been isolated as molecular species in inert-gas matrices at low temperatures, and studied by IR and UV/VIS spectroscopy.In particular, the electronic spectra are described and the principal charge-transfer bands assigned using the optical electronegativity model.This suggested that a new value for χopt(F-) of 3.6 is appropriate for transition-metal oxide fluorides.
